Tweets that disappear after 24 hours
Twitter is testing a new feature called “Fleets” that lets users post temporary content that disappears after 24 hours. This feature is similar to Instagram stories, but unlike Instagram, it is not retweetable, likened, or publicly replied to. It’s unclear if this new feature will be rolled out internationally or only in Brazil. However, it is worth mentioning that this feature is still in beta testing and some users have already complained.
Like Instagram Stories, Fleets are primarily composed of text, but can also include GIFs or videos. They are visible to users’ followers and are available to reply via private direct message. In November 2020, Twitter launched a feature called Fleets. It was meant to rival Instagram and Snapchat’s stories, and Twitter hoped it would attract new users. However, it ended up attracting only the most powerful Twitter users. In August 2021, the feature was killed off and replaced by the Spaces feature.
